New Caledonia is not just a paradise island in the South Pacific; it is a land where the horse is king. With a long breeding tradition and the influence of the “Stockmen” culture (Caledonian cowboys), equestrian activity here is vibrant and diverse. Whether for leisure, sport, breeding or cattle work, the equestrian property market in the Pacific has highly specific characteristics that appeal to locals as well as metropolitan and international investors.
The Caledonian horse population is estimated at several thousand head, divided between station horses, sport horses (show jumping, dressage) and racehorses. Horse riding is a major sport here, with many licensed riders and emblematic events such as the Bourail Fair, a true institution celebrating rural life.
When looking for an equestrian property to buy in New Caledonia, it is essential to understand the geography of the “Caillou”. Listings are generally concentrated in two distinct areas with very different lifestyles:
For those who want to combine professional life in the capital with a passion for horses, Greater Nouméa and its surroundings are ideal. You will often find the type of property “villa with land for horses”, allowing you to keep your horses at home while staying close to amenities. The Dumbéa area and the Païta area are particularly sought after for their green valleys and large plots. Likewise, Mont-Dore offers spacious plots where it is possible to set up a house with paddocks. Many private stables and riding centres oriented towards classical riding on ponies and horses are also concentrated here.
As soon as you leave Nouméa heading north, you enter “the Bush”. This is the land of wide open spaces, niaouli trees and endless pastures. The Boulouparis area and the La Foa area are transition zones offering attractive agricultural land. Further north, the Bourail region is the beating heart of Caledonian livestock farming. Here you can find a breeding station for sale (local term for large extensive livestock farms) or an authentic bush ranch. These properties often have several dozen or even hundreds of hectares of flat or rolling land, perfect for horse breeding in freedom.
The properties available in the department (988) vary considerably. You can find a luxurious horse estate with a swimming pool, as well as a rustic equestrian farm ready to be renovated. Water supply is a crucial factor in this tropical climate: the presence of a natural water point or, better still, a permanent creek is an invaluable asset for watering the herd and irrigation.
